What You'll Do
As a Project Manager, you'll be responsible for developing new business while managing customer projects from initial contact through successful completion.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Develop new customer relationships while growing existing accounts.
- Meet with customers to understand project needs and recommend the best solutions.
- Prepare project estimates, bids, proposals, and service quotes.
- Manage projects from bid award through completion, ensuring quality, accuracy, and customer satisfaction.
- Coordinate closely with Customer Service, Dispatch, Operations, and Finance to keep projects on schedule.
- Maintain ongoing communication with customers regarding schedules, project updates, and expectations.
- Follow up after project completion to ensure an exceptional customer experience.
- Increase revenue through cross-selling and identifying additional customer needs.
- Stay current on industry trends, local regulations, and company services.
- Maintain accurate customer records, work orders, and project documentation.
- Effectively prioritize multiple projects while meeting deadlines.
- Represent the company with professionalism, integrity, and outstanding customer service.
- Perform other duties as assigned.

Physical Requirements
This position requires a combination of office and field work. Candidates should be able to:
- Sit or stand for extended periods.
- Walk job sites as needed.
- Bend, stoop, kneel, and climb occasionally.
- Lift and carry materials or equipment as required.
- Work both indoors and outdoors in varying weather conditions.
